Is it possible to login into a streaming service such as Netflix/Disney+/etc on my iPhone and then have a movie play on the backseat screens? Or are DVDs the only way?
 
1605924247902.jpeg
 
I made several attempts to make those screens useful before I removed them. No streaming was possible. The connection (hardwire only) is too primitive to allow anything but fairly old input devices. Not all DVD players work either.

edit: from posts below it looks like I didn’t try hard enough or used the wrong cords for streaming. Since it works on a ‘16 and an ‘18, it will work on a ‘17.
 
Last edited:
It might depend on your LC year. I can use a USB to HDMI cable to stream from my Android phone. Others have reported that it works from their iPhones with the name-brand Apple lightning-to-HDMI cable.

I have used my tablet over the USB to HDMI cable and it work good, just extra wires.
 
I use a Roku stick in the hdmi port. Works great and the kid is happy. Netflix and Amazon prime work from an iPhone tethered connection to the roku.
